Factors Affecting the Price Range of Spherical Rollers

Material Quality

The material used in the production of spherical rollers is a fundamental determinant of their price. High - quality materials such as premium steel alloys offer superior durability, resistance to wear and tear, and enhanced performance under extreme conditions. These rollers can withstand heavy loads, high speeds, and harsh environments, making them ideal for critical applications. For instance, in the mining industry, where equipment operates in abrasive and high - stress conditions, spherical rollers made from high - grade steel are essential. On the other hand, rollers made from standard or lower - grade materials are more affordable but may have limitations in terms of lifespan and performance. They are often used in less demanding applications where cost is a significant factor.

Size and Dimensions

The size of spherical rollers also has a substantial impact on their price. Larger rollers generally require more raw material and more complex manufacturing processes. For example, in large - scale industrial machinery like rolling mills or wind turbines, the spherical rollers can be several inches in diameter. Producing these large - sized rollers involves more precise machining and quality control to ensure they meet the required specifications. Smaller spherical rollers, commonly used in consumer electronics or small - scale machinery, are less expensive as they use less material and are easier to manufacture.

Precision and Tolerance

Precision is another crucial factor. Spherical rollers with high precision and tight tolerances are more expensive. These rollers are designed for applications where accuracy is of the utmost importance, such as in aerospace or medical equipment. The manufacturing process for high - precision rollers involves advanced machining techniques and strict quality control measures to ensure that the rollers meet the exact specifications. In contrast, rollers with looser tolerances are more suitable for general - purpose applications and are priced more competitively.

Design Complexity

The design of spherical rollers can vary greatly. Some rollers have a simple, standard design, while others feature complex geometries or additional features. Rollers with unique designs that offer better load - distribution or higher efficiency will typically cost more than standard designs.

Price Range Overview

Low - End Range

In the low - end price range, you can find spherical rollers that are suitable for general - purpose applications with relatively low loads and speeds. These rollers are often made from standard materials and have looser tolerances. They are commonly used in small - scale machinery, such as conveyor systems in light - industrial settings or household appliances. The price for these rollers can start from as low as a few dollars per piece, depending on the size. For example, small - sized spherical rollers with a diameter of less than an inch and made from basic steel alloys can be purchased in bulk at a very affordable price.

Mid - Range

The mid - range price segment offers a balance between quality and cost. Rollers in this range are made from better - quality materials and have more precise manufacturing processes. They are suitable for a wide range of industrial applications, including medium - sized machinery in the automotive, food processing, and packaging industries. The price for mid - range spherical rollers can range from around $10 to $100 per piece, depending on the size, material, and design. For instance, a medium - sized spherical roller with a diameter of a few inches and made from a good - quality steel alloy may fall within this price range.

High - End Range

The high - end price range includes spherical rollers that are designed for critical and high - performance applications. These rollers are made from the highest - quality materials, have extremely tight tolerances, and often feature advanced designs. They are used in industries such as aerospace, power generation, and heavy - duty mining. The price for high - end spherical rollers can exceed $100 per piece and can go up to several thousand dollars for large, specialized rollers. For example, large - diameter spherical rollers used in high - speed turbines or in deep - sea drilling equipment are in this high - end price category.

Comparison with Other Types of Rollers

It's also interesting to compare the price range of spherical rollers with other types of rollers. Cylindrical Roller and Interroll Tapered Roller are two common alternatives. Cylindrical rollers are often used in applications where high radial loads need to be supported. Their price range is similar to that of spherical rollers, but the cost can vary depending on the same factors such as material, size, and precision. Interroll tapered rollers are designed for applications where both radial and axial loads need to be handled. They may be more expensive than spherical rollers in some cases, especially when they are designed for high - performance applications.
